Resumen:
The coarsening dynamics of two dimensional hexagonal phases deposited on curved backgrounds is studied for the first time by using numerical simulations. An initial liquid¬like disordered system is quenched into the hexagonal phase and the ordering process is followed as a function of time for different curvatures of the underlying substrate. Early hexagonal seeds preferentially form in regions of low curvature, where the geometrical frustration in the lattice is reduced. The growth of these seeds creates a polycrystalline phase containing out of equilibrium defect configurations. Further relaxation towards equilibrium involves mechanisms of grain growth and defect annihilation, where the strain field introduced by the geometry is partially screened out by topological defects.
